Outdoor Cushions
Outdoor fabric is especially designed to reduce fading and inhibit the growth of mould on the fabric. I leave my cushions out all year round and they get the full western sun every afternoon, and they have survived well. All I do is give them a clean from time to time. I use 1/4 cup of mild laundry detergent (or Vanish Oxyaction) in 1 gallon (3.8 litres) of lukewarm water (30C).
